Data processing units (DPUs), also known as high-performance, reprogrammable processors and contemporary network interfaces, are designed specifically to perform and accelerate the network and storage tasks that data centre servers are responsible for. DPUs enable servers to transfer network and storage tasks from the CPU to the DPU, freeing up the CPU to concentrate only on managing the operating systems and system applications. It efficiently handles data-centric workloads such as data transfer, reduction, security, compression, analytics, and encryption, at scale in data centres.

An advanced persistent threat (APT) is a targeted network attack that invades the network and remains undiscovered for a considerable amount of time. APT attacks are designed to observe network activity and steal data over an extended period of time, rather than breach systems or networks. Its attacks are frequently used by cybercriminals to target high-value targets like major enterprises and government organisations in order to acquire important or strategic data. The Graphics Processing Unit (GPU) segment is estimated to hold the largest share. GPUs can process a lot of data at once, which makes them useful for applications like machine learning, video editing, and gaming. GPUs are generally quicker and more powerful than CPUs for data analytics jobs due to their parallel processing capabilities. This implies they can handle massive datasets and complex computations more efficiently, leading to faster processing times and improved performance. It facilitates and improves emerging technologies, including rendering, analytics, simulation and modelling, and artificial intelligence (AI).
